Which of the following statements is/are correct? 1. The jet streams are high altitude easterly winds. 2. El Ni?s a warm ocean current. 3. El Ni?ppears along the Peru coast. Select the correct answer using the code given below.

Explanation

Statement 1 is incorrect because jet streams are primarily high-altitude westerlies, flowing from west to east in both hemispheres [1]. While a temporary Tropical Easterly Jet exists during the Indian summer monsoon, the general global jet streams (Polar and Subtropical) are westerly [1]. Statement 2 is correct as El Niño is defined as a warm ocean current that represents the warm phase of the Southern Oscillation [4]. Statement 3 is correct because this warming occurs along the coasts of Peru and Ecuador, typically appearing around December [5]. During El Niño, the normal cold Peruvian current is replaced by warm water, which suppresses the upwelling of cold deep ocean water and alters global weather patterns, including causing droughts in the western Pacific and heavy rains in South America [4].
